MB-GPS-1

GPS location transducer

Based on the received signal, the MB-GPS-1 transmitter provides 

current data for its location:

»

geographical coordinates (longitude/latitude);

»

date (year/month/day);

»

time (hour/minutes/seconds).

The device is equipped with the location module of the GPS 

(Global Positioning System) and the GLONASS system (Russian: 

ГЛОНАСС,  Глобальная  навигационная  спутниковая  система,  

Globalnaja nawigacionnaja sputnikowaja sistiema).

The device, based on one of these signals, provides current data 

for its location: geographical coordinates (length and width), 

date and time.

If the satellite signal is lost, the device continues the countdown 

in the internal clock. When the satellite signal is re-established, 

the internal clock time is synchronized to the received value.
